当你在浏览器中打开Telegram网页版(web.telegram.org)时,页面一直转圈、提示“连接中”或直接显示“登录失败”,无法正常使用。这个问题通常源于网络环境、浏览器设置或账号状态异常,而非Telegram服务器本身故障。下面从准备到验证,一步步帮你解决。
检查网络连接与代理配置
这是最可能的原因,Telegram网页版需要稳定的国际网络连接。
具体操作说明:
首先,打开其他国外网站(如Google或Github),看能否正常访问。如果不能,说明你的网络环境存在问题。接着,检查你使用的代理工具是否开启并处于“全局模式”或“规则模式”。在浏览器地址栏输入 web.telegram.org后,按 F12打开开发者工具,切换到 Network(网络)选项卡,刷新页面,查看是否有红色报错或长时间“pending”的请求。
注意事项/小提示:
- 确保代理软件已正确运行,并且代理端口没有被其他程序占用。
- 如果使用浏览器插件(如SwitchyOmega),请确认其设置为“系统代理”或直接选择你的代理协议。
- 部分校园网或公司网络会封锁Telegram域名,此时必须使用代理。
备用方案:
- 尝试更换代理节点,例如从香港节点切换到日本或美国节点。
- 关闭代理,使用手机热点(如果手机网络能正常访问Telegram)测试是否能登录。
- 重启路由器,清除DNS缓存:在电脑命令提示符中运行
ipconfig /flushdns。
清除浏览器缓存与Cookie
浏览器存储的旧数据可能干扰网页版登录过程。
具体操作说明:
在浏览器右上角点击菜单按钮(通常是三个点或三条横线),选择 设置(或“更多工具” → “清除浏览数据”)。在时间范围中选择 所有时间,勾选 缓存的图片和文件以及 Cookie和其他站点数据。点击 清除数据。完成后,关闭所有浏览器窗口,重新打开并访问Telegram网页版。
注意事项/小提示:
- 清除Cookie会导致其他网站也需要重新登录,建议先导出重要网站的登录信息。
- 如果使用Chrome,也可以按快捷键 Ctrl+Shift+Delete(Windows)或 Command+Shift+Delete(Mac)直接调出清除窗口。
- 不要只清除“过去一小时”的数据,必须选择“所有时间”才能彻底清除。
备用方案:
- 尝试使用浏览器的 无痕模式(隐私模式)访问网页版,该模式默认不加载旧缓存和Cookie。
- 如果无痕模式能登录,说明是正常模式下的缓存问题,后续可定期清理。
检查浏览器兼容性与更新
过时或不兼容的浏览器可能导致网页版无法正常渲染或执行JavaScript。
具体操作说明:
打开浏览器 关于页面(通常在设置菜单中),检查浏览器版本是否为最新。如果不是,点击 更新按钮进行升级。同时,确认你的浏览器支持WebRTC和WebSocket技术(现代浏览器均支持)。可以尝试在地址栏输入 chrome://version/(Chrome)或 about:config(Firefox)查看版本信息。
注意事项/小提示:
- 推荐使用最新版 Chrome、Firefox或 Edge浏览器。旧版IE或Safari可能无法正常使用。
- 如果浏览器有插件(如广告拦截器),尝试暂时禁用所有插件,因为某些插件会阻止Telegram的API请求。
- 部分企业定制版浏览器(如360安全浏览器)可能存在兼容问题,建议换用Chrome。
备用方案:
- 安装一个不同的浏览器(如从Chrome换到Firefox)进行登录测试。
- 在手机浏览器中访问网页版,排除电脑浏览器本身的问题。
使用正确的登录方式与二维码
Telegram网页版有手机号和二维码两种登录入口,选择错误或操作不当会导致失败。
具体操作说明:
打开网页版后,你会看到两个选项:手机号登录和 二维码登录。如果你选择手机号登录,请确保输入国家代码(中国大陆为+86)和完整手机号,点击下一步后,Telegram客户端会收到一个登录验证码。如果你选择二维码登录,则必须在手机Telegram App中打开 设置→ 设备→ 扫描二维码,扫描网页上的二维码。
注意事项/小提示:
- 手机号登录时,验证码会发送到你的Telegram App内,而非短信。请保持手机App在线。
- 二维码登录更快捷,但要求手机App已登录且与网页版处于同一网络环境(不强制,但建议)。
- 如果输入手机号后长时间未收到验证码,可能是网络延迟,等待1-2分钟后再试,不要反复点击“重发”。
备用方案:
- 如果手机号登录失败,尝试先断开代理,再重新连接后重试。
- 如果二维码无法扫描,尝试刷新网页生成新的二维码,并确保手机摄像头权限已开启。
- 使用手机浏览器访问
web.telegram.org,通过手机号登录(此时验证码会发送到手机App)。
验证账号状态与设备限制
账号被限制登录或已达到设备数量上限,会导致网页版登录被拒。
具体操作说明:
登录失败后,注意看是否有具体提示,如“登录尝试过多,请稍后再试”或“此设备已被禁止”。如果提示“登录尝试过多”,说明你的IP或账号触发了反滥用机制,需要等待15-30分钟后再试。如果提示“设备限制”,说明你的账号已经在5个设备上登录(Telegram免费版最多允许5个设备同时在线),需要先在手机App中移除一个设备。
注意事项/小提示:
- 频繁切换代理或多次输入错误验证码最容易触发“登录尝试过多”限制。
- 在手机App中,进入 设置→ 设备,可以查看已登录的设备列表,点击不需要的设备进行移除。
- 如果账号被临时封禁(如发送垃圾消息),网页版会直接显示“账号已禁用”,此时需通过官方申诉渠道解封。
备用方案:
- 等待30分钟后,使用不同的IP(如切换代理节点或使用手机4G网络)重新尝试登录。
- 如果怀疑账号被盗,立即在手机App中更改密码并开启两步验证。
使用Telegram官方桌面客户端作为备用
如果以上方法均无效,网页版可能因浏览器环境问题无法修复,此时应改用官方桌面客户端。
具体操作说明:
访问Telegram官方网站 telegram.org,在 Apps页面找到对应你操作系统的桌面客户端(Windows、macOS、Linux)。下载并安装后,运行客户端。登录方式与网页版类似:输入手机号或扫描二维码。客户端使用原生协议,通常比网页版更稳定。
注意事项/小提示:
- 桌面客户端同样需要代理才能连接,但它的连接稳定性优于网页版。
- 客户端支持多账号切换,且资源占用比浏览器低。
- 首次登录客户端时,可能会要求输入验证码,请保持手机App在线。
备用方案:
- 如果桌面客户端也登录不上,说明问题出在代理或网络层面,而非Telegram本身。
- 尝试使用 Telegram X(第三方客户端,仅限Android)或其他轻量级客户端。
- 终极方案:在手机App中直接使用,通过手机完成所有通讯需求。
常见问题补充
问:登录时一直显示“连接中”,等了很久也没反应怎么办?
答:这通常是代理配置问题。检查代理是否开启,尝试更换节点或关闭代理后重新开启。如果代理正常,尝试在浏览器地址栏直接输入 https://web.telegram.org/k/(使用K版本)或 https://web.telegram.org/a/(使用A版本),这两个版本可能对某些网络环境兼容性更好。
问:二维码扫描后,手机App提示“链接已过期”怎么办?
答:二维码有效期为60秒。刷新网页生成新二维码后,立即用手机App扫描。如果仍然过期,检查手机和电脑的时间是否同步,时间偏差过大会导致二维码验证失败。
问:在无痕模式下能登录,正常模式下不行,怎么彻底解决?
答:这说明正常模式下的缓存或扩展插件有问题。先清除所有浏览器数据和Cookie,然后逐一禁用扩展插件,找出导致冲突的那个。如果无法定位,可以重置浏览器设置到初始状态。
总结:
Telegram网页版登录不了,90%的根源在于网络代理配置或浏览器缓存,按照“检查网络→清理缓存→更换登录方式→验证账号状态”的顺序排查,通常无需求助即可解决。